Revolutionary Design
Central to its groundbreaking design, the Starship offers a fully reusable structure, seamlessly reducing the costs of interplanetary journeys. This colossal spacecraft boasts a massive payload capacity, ready to transport crew and cargo to destinations like the Moon and Mars, making it an ideal candidate for ambitious cosmic escapades.
Environmental Vision
Emphasizing environmental responsibility, the Starship uses methane fuel, crucial for slashing carbon emissions on Earth and possibly producible on Mars. This innovation hints at a visionary plan: a self-sustained human presence on Mars with local fuel production.

Q1: What are the key features that make SpaceX’s Starship revolutionary for space travel?
The Starship is a game-changing spacecraft with several innovative features:
– Fully Reusable Design: Its reusability significantly lowers the cost of space travel, breaking new ground in affordability for interplanetary missions.
– Enormous Payload Capacity: The Starship can transport massive amounts of cargo and passengers to destinations like the Moon and Mars, paving the way for interplanetary colonization.
– Methane-Based Fuel: Using methane reduces carbon emissions compared to traditional rocket fuels and can be produced on Mars, supporting long-term human settlement.
Q2: How does the Starship’s design contribute to environmental sustainability in space exploration?
The Starship enhances sustainability through:
– Methane Fuel Utilization: Methane leads to cleaner burning and is potentially producible on Mars, supporting a self-sustaining fuel cycle.
– Reduced Emissions: The switch to cleaner fuels in space travel aligns with global efforts to minimize greenhouse gases.
